      3D Graphics Designer Interview

      6 Feb 2016
      Anonymous employee
      Accepted offer
      Neutral experience

      Application

      I interviewed at 3000AD in June 2014

      I applied through a recruiter. 
      The process took 1 day. 

      Interview

      It was very brief. I was asked about my location, and we discussed how I could relay my projects and what accounts could be used to receive payment after. Normally I tend to accept only commission projects, though an hourly pay seemed better, as I shamelessly felt that I could reliably remain involved in the project and receive work. To be honest, I had hoped for a position that would be entirely permanent, going from this, to the many that I felt would follow. To say that I had been fooled, would be an understatement.

      Interview questions [1]

      Question 1

      "Would you be willing to accept an hourly rate with a set cap? We'd be willing to start you at twenty dollars and hour."
